#  Sunshine Act Meetings

**AGENCY:**

Election Assistance Commission.

**DATE AND TIME:**

Wednesday, February 18, 2015 at 10:00 a.m.

**PLACE:**

1335 East West Highway (First Floor Conference Room), Silver Spring, MD 20910.

**STATUS:**

This meeting will be open to the public.

**ITEMS TO BE DISCUSSED:**

Selection of Chair and Vice-Chair

Accreditation Decision for Pro V&V

Briefing and Discussion of Voluntary Voting Systems Guidelines (VVSG 1.1)

Briefing and Discussion of Program Manuals

Discussion and Consideration of Roles and Responsibilities Document

**AGENDA:**

Commissioners will meet to select a chair and vice-chair and to discuss the following items: Accreditation Decision for Pro V&V; Briefing and Discussion of Voluntary Voting Systems Guidelines (VVSG 1.1); Briefing and Discussion of Program Manuals; and Discussion and Consideration of Roles and Responsibilities Document.

**PUBLIC COMMENTS:**

Members of the public who wish to speak at the meeting on proposed changes to the Voluntary Voting Systems Guidelines VVSG 1.1 may send a request to participate to the EAC no later than 5:00 p.m. EDT on Thursday, February 12, 2015. Due to time constraints, the EAC will select no more than 7 participants to speak. Each of those selected will be allotted 5 minutes. Participants will be selected on a first-come, first-served basis. However, to maximize diversity of input, only one participant per organization or entity will be chosen, if necessary. Participants will receive confirmation by 12:00 p.m. EDT on Thursday, February 13, 2015. Requests to speak may be sent to the EAC via email at *[email protected],* via standard mail addressed to the U.S. Election Assistance Commission, 1335 East West Highway, Suite 4300, Silver Spring, MD 20910, or by fax at 301-734-3108. All requests must include a description of the topic to be discussed, contact information that will be used to notify the requestor with status of request (phone number or email); include on the subject/attention line or on the outside of the envelope if by standard mail: EAC Public Meeting.
